Describe the bug
Extension Sample Part 2 produces a runtime exception error.

Unchecked runtime.lastError: Could not establish connection. Receiving end does not exist.

To Reproduce
Steps to reproduce the behavior:

  1. Clone this repo
  2. Open edge and install the extension in the directory MicrosoftEdge-Extensions\Extension samples\extension-getting-started-part2\extension-getting-started-part2
  3. Open the extension and click on the display button
    image
  4. Nothing will happen.
  5. Go to the installed extensions list in edge and click on the errors button.
    image

Expected behavior
The result documented here

Desktop (please complete the following information):

  • Windows 10
  • Microsoft Edge for Business
  • Version 121.0.2277.83 (Official build) (64-bit)
